I'm using myfitnesspal to keep track of my calories and exercise. What's good is that it's free and you can get a mobile app.

I did this before pregnancy and lost 10kg (about 22ish pounds) in 3 months just by exercising 3 times a week and eating right.

Use myfitness pal to calculate how many calories you are eating on an average day; it's a real eye opener. What's your typical day eating wise? Using myfitness pal can help you start making changes to your diet. Good luck xx
